On average across the year,
yes, Georgia, United States is hotter than
Lincoln, Nebraska
.
Georgia, United States has an average temperature of 18°C/64°F and Lincoln, Nebraska has an average temperature of 11°C/52°F.
Georgia, United States's hottest month is July, with an average maximum temperature of 33°C/91°F, which is hotter than Lincoln, Nebraska's hottest month (also July, with an average maximum temperature of 32°C/90°F).
On average across the year, no, Georgia, United States is not colder than Lincoln, Nebraska . Georgia, United States has an average minimum temperature of 12°C/54°F and Lincoln, Nebraska has an average minimum temperature of 5°C/41°F.
On average across the year,
yes, Georgia, United States has more rain than
Lincoln, Nebraska. Georgia, United States has an average annual rainfall of 1387mm and Lincoln, Nebraska has an average annual rainfall of 862mm.
Georgia, United States's wettest month is December, with an average monthly rainfall of 147mm, which is drier than Lincoln, Nebraska's wettest month (May, with an average monthly rainfall of 159mm).
